At Officer Smiles, we offer a variety of dental crowns and bridges to suit your needs. Dental crowns are an ideal solution for heavily filled, damaged and stained teeth, as they can help to restore both the function and the appearance of your smile. Bridges are commonly used to fill in gaps left by missing teeth.
In addition to improving the aesthetics of your smile, bridges can also help to prevent movement of the surrounding teeth. We offer both traditional and implant-supported bridges, depending on your preferences. Whether it is a single dental crown or multiple bridges, we design and prepare your tooth to receive the pristine and long lasting restoration for many years to come.

Dental implants are a popular and effective way to replace missing teeth. They are typically made of titanium and are surgically placed in the jawbone. Over time, the bone fuse with the implant, creating a strong and stable foundation for artificial teeth. Dental implants can be used to support a single tooth, a dental bridge, or a full set of dentures.

Having a child who experiences jaw maldevelopment or poor oral habits can be worrying, but fortunately there is a solution. Myobrace for children uses gentle forces and activities to help positions shift over time to improve the function and development of the patient’s mouth.
This can all be done using light forces that do not put pressure down on the teeth itself, creating a comfortable atmosphere with minimal disruption to everyday activities, making it perfect for children or those who don't desire more involved treatments for correcting their maldevelopment or oral habits.

A dentist will always want to understand their patients before starting any treatment, which is why the first visit is always focused on a consultation. The dentist will ask about your medical history, your lifestyle and any current oral health concerns you may have before carrying out a thorough examination of your teeth and gums. They will also examine your mouth, teeth, and gums, looking for any signs of tooth decay or other problems.
If necessary, the dentist may also take X-rays to get a better view of your teeth and jawbone. Based on the information they gather; the dentist will then develop a treatment plan customized to your needs. The first visit is an important opportunity for the dentist to get to know you and your oral health needs, so that they can provide the best possible care.
The short answer is yes, you should see a dentist every six months for a routine cleaning and check-up. Although you may not think you need to go so often, there are several good reasons to stick to this schedule. First of all, regular cleanings remove plaque and tartar build-up that can lead to tooth decay and gum disease.
Secondly, dentists can spot early signs of trouble, such as a small cavity, and take steps to prevent it from getting worse. Finally, seeing a dentist on a regular basis helps to build a relationship of trust and mutual understanding. When it comes to your oral health, it's always better to be safe than sorry. A dental check-up is a vital part of maintaining good oral health. During a check-up, your family dentist will examine your teeth and gums for any signs of decay or disease. They will also check for any potential problems, such as gum disease or tooth loss.
In addition, your dentist will clean your teeth and remove any plaque or tartar build-up. They may also recommend flossing and brushing your teeth more regularly. A dental check-up is an important way to maintain good oral health and catch any problems early.
